Pular para conteúdo

Planejamento da Verificação da Etapa 1 do Grupo 2

Introdução

A verificação é uma das etapas mais importantes do desenvolvimento de um projeto. Nela os artefatos produzidos são analisados garantindo que os mesmos cumpram com os seus requisitos especificados. Sendo assim, este documento apresenta o planejamento da verificação dos artefatos produzidos pelo Grupo 2 na Etapa 1.

Objetivos

O objetivo deste documento é verificar se os artefatos produzidos na Etapa 1 do Grupo 2 possuem os itens e o padrão exigidos para tais. É importante citar que essa verificação em momento nenhum busca diminuir os membros do Grupo 2 ou seu trabalho, apenas aplicar os conceitos de verificação nos artefatos.

Metodologia

A metodologia escolhida para esta verificação é uma adptação da inspeção. Desenvolvida originalmente para códigos de software por Fagan na IBM em 1976, essa técnica consiste em uma revisão formal dos artefatos produzidos a fim de se encontrar defeitos, a figura 1 exemplifica as etapas que Fagan propôs para esse processo.

Salienta-se que a inspeção aqui planejada será realizada somente até a etapa de "Reunião de Inspeção", que nessa adaptacação será a inspeção propriamente dita, realizada de maneira individual. Essa revisão será realizada através de uma checklist onde se tem uma lista com os defeitos mais comuns que deverão ser identificados, analisados e classificados, tudo isso com base na bibliografia especificada pelo autor da checklist.

Figura 1 - Etapas da Inspeção de acordo com Fagan.

inspecao-fagan

Fonte: SOMMERVILLE (2007).1

Participantes

A responsável por essa verificação é a integrante Geovanna Maciel, que realizou tanto o planejamento quanto a inspeção e o relato de seus resultados. A revisão dos artefatos produzidos por essa verificação fica a cargo do integrante do Grupo 1 Gabriel Campelo.

Objetos de Verificação

O artefato alvo dessa verificação é:

Cronograma

A verificação será realizada no período de 3 de junho de 2023 até dia 5 de junho de 2023, com os resultados sendo relatados através da página de documentação do Grupo 1 no dia 05 de junho de 2023. A tabela 1 a seguir, apresenta o cronograma das atividades a serem realizadas.

Tabela 1 - Cronograma das Atividades.

Data Descrição Responsável
03/06/2023 Verificação das Personas. Geovanna Maciel
05/06/2023 Adição dos resultados. Geovanna Maciel

Fonte: Geovanna Maciel

Checklists

As checklists foram construídas levando em conta os padrões esperados para cada artefato e as principais tarefas realizadas na elaboração dos mesmos, tudo isso de acordo com os documentos Introducing Rich Picture e os slides da Aula 04 da professora Milene e Maurício Serrano.

Com o intuito de melhor organizar a verificação, a checklist será dividida em 2 checklists sendo que 5 perguntas deverão estar presente em todas as etapas de verificação, assim como expressado na tabela 2. A checklist destinada para o conteúdo do Rich Picture estará presente na tabela 3.

Geral

Tabela 2 - Checklist para os Itens Gerais.

ID Descrição Avaliação
1 O artefato possui Introdução?
2 O artefato possui uma bibliografia/referência bibliográfica?
3 O artefato possui um histórico de versões com o id e descrição das versões, data, autores e revisores?
4 Todas as tabelas e imagens são chamadas no texto, possuem legendas e fontes?
5 Todos os textos estão na norma padrão?

Fonte: Matheus Henrique.

Verificação do Rich Picture

Tabela 3 - Checklist para a Verificação do Rich Picture.

ID Descrição Avaliação
6 O rich picture possui atores, operações, armazenamento de dados, setas e o limite do sistema? 2.
7 Foi utilizada alguma técnica na produção do rich picture? 2.
8 O rich picture possui mais textos do que imagens? 3.
9 O artefato está bem desenhado e é possível de ser entendido? 3.
10 Ele conta uma história? 3.
11 O rich picture diz qual dado está sendo processado, qual está chegando ao sistema e qual informação está saindo? 3.
12 O rich picture dá uma ideia do que realmente está acontecendo? 3.
13 Contém palavras-chave relevantes? 3.
14 Comunica mais ideias do que palavras? 3.
15 Contém a explicação dos componentes? 3.

Fonte: Geovanna Maciel.

Bibliografia

ESTEVES, Luíza. Planejamento da Verificação da Etapa 5. Repositório do Grupo Agência Virtual Neoenergia Brasília da disciplina de Interação Humano Computador da Universidade de Brasília, 2022. Disponível em: <https://interacao-humano-computador.github.io/2022.1-AgenciaVirtualNeoenergia/verifica%C3%A7%C3%A3o_dos_artefatos/etapa_5/planejamento/>. Acesso em: 30 maio 2023.

MACEDO, Lucas. Planejamento da Verificação - PC5. Repositório do Grupo Lichess da disciplina de Interação Humano Computador da Universidade de Brasília, 2022. Disponível em: <https://interacao-humano-computador.github.io/2022.2-Lichess/verificacao_validacao/pc5-planejamento/>. Acesso em: 30 maio 2023.

1.Sommerville, Ian. Engenharia de software. 08. ed. São Paulo: Pearson Addison Wesley, 2007

2.Slides da aula “Requisitos – Aula 04” dos professores Milene Serrano e Maurício Serrano. Disponível em: https://aprender3.unb.br/pluginfile.php/2523041/mod_resource/content/3/Requisitos%20-%20Aula%2004.pdf. Acessado em: 03 de junho de 2023.

3.Introducing Rich Pictures - Rich Picture Drawing Guidelines. Disponível em: https://aprender3.unb.br/pluginfile.php/2523045/mod_resource/content/2/1_5145791542719414573.pdf. Acessado em: 03 de junho de 2023

Histórico de Versões

Versão Data Descrição Autor(es) Revisor(es)
1.0 03/06/2023 Criação do documento. Geovanna Maciel Gabriel Campelo
1.1 09/06/2023 Adição das referências nas tabelas Geovanna Maciel Gabriel Campelo